Aloina brevirostris
From Natural History of Southeast Alaska
Aloina brevirostris:
Family: Pottiaceae
Status: Unlikely
Abundance: Not known to occur
BFNA Treatment of Aloina brevirostris
Southeastern Alaska Distribution: Known only from Glacier Bay (Steere, 1950).
Habitat: On bare, unconsolidated, basic soils.
Comments: The report of the species from Glacier Bay represents the southern limit of the species on the coast for North America.
